HomeSort by relevance Sort by last modified time
    Searched refs:SkGlyphPos (Results 1 - 9 of 9) sorted by null

  /external/skia/src/core/
SkGlyphRunPainter.h 122 SkAutoTMalloc<SkGlyphPos> fGlyphPos;
124 std::vector<SkGlyphPos> fPaths;
149 virtual void processDeviceMasks(SkSpan<const SkGlyphPos> masks,
152 virtual void processSourcePaths(SkSpan<const SkGlyphPos> paths,
155 virtual void processDevicePaths(SkSpan<const SkGlyphPos> paths) = 0;
157 virtual void processSourceSDFT(SkSpan<const SkGlyphPos> masks,
165 virtual void processSourceFallback(SkSpan<const SkGlyphPos> masks,
170 virtual void processDeviceFallback(SkSpan<const SkGlyphPos> masks,
SkStrikeInterface.h 55 struct SkGlyphPos {
73 virtual int glyphMetrics(const SkGlyphID[], const SkPoint[], int n, SkGlyphPos result[]) = 0;
SkRemoteGlyphCacheImpl.h 46 int glyphMetrics(const SkGlyphID[], const SkPoint[], int n, SkGlyphPos result[]) override;
SkGlyphRunPainter.cpp 316 SkSpan<const SkGlyphPos>{fGlyphPos, SkTo<size_t>(drawableGlyphCount)},
361 SkSpan<const SkGlyphPos>{fGlyphPos, SkTo<size_t>(glyphCount)},
413 std::vector<SkGlyphPos> paths;
445 SkSpan<const SkGlyphPos>{fGlyphPos, SkTo<size_t>(glyphCount)},
456 SkSpan<const SkGlyphPos>{paths}, strike.get(), cacheToSourceScale);
517 SkSpan<const SkGlyphPos>{fGlyphPos, SkTo<size_t>(glyphCount)},
582 SkSpan<const SkGlyphPos>{fGlyphPos, SkTo<size_t>(glyphsWithMaskCount)},
586 process->processDevicePaths(SkSpan<const SkGlyphPos>{fPaths});
    [all...]
SkStrike.h 139 int glyphMetrics(const SkGlyphID[], const SkPoint[], int n, SkGlyphPos result[]) override;
SkStrike.cpp 243 SkGlyphPos result[]) {
SkStrikeCache.cpp 40 const SkGlyphID id[], const SkPoint point[], int n, SkGlyphPos result[]) override {
SkRemoteGlyphCache.cpp 602 const SkGlyphID glyphIDs[], const SkPoint positions[], int n, SkGlyphPos result[]) {
  /external/skia/src/gpu/text/
GrTextBlob.h 526 void processDeviceMasks(SkSpan<const SkGlyphPos> masks,
529 void processSourcePaths(SkSpan<const SkGlyphPos> paths,
532 void processDevicePaths(SkSpan<const SkGlyphPos> paths) override;
534 void processSourceSDFT(SkSpan<const SkGlyphPos> masks,
542 void processSourceFallback(SkSpan<const SkGlyphPos> masks,
547 void processDeviceFallback(SkSpan<const SkGlyphPos> masks,

Completed in 1127 milliseconds